What does it mean when your baby’s head is engaged?

WebEngagement means the widest part of the baby’s head has dipped below the entrance to the pelvis (the brim). WebAround 95% of babies will now be head down, facing their mother's back, which is the best position for labour. When the baby's head moves down into the pelvis, it's said to be "engaged". You might see your bump drop a bit when this happens. If your baby's still in the bottom-down position (breech) don't worry, there's still time for them to turn.
